Abstract
We describe continuous-wave, red, orange, green, and blue upconversion laser output for various lengths of ZBLAN fluorozirconate fiber doped with trivalent praseodymium and ytterbium ions. The lasers operate at room temperature, are modestly tunable, and are pumped either with a single Ti:sapphire laser tuned anywhere in the 780-880-nm wavelength region, or a single 860-nm semiconductor diode laser
